And although Webster was delighted just to be back in the Edinburgh set-up after his injury hell, he is only thinking about getting game time before he can contemplate returning to the Scotland ranks.
He said: “I’d like to think that I’m in a better position to play well than I was even two months ago when I first became available for selection.
“But I’m not thinking far ahead. I’m not thinking about the World Cup. I know it's a cliché, but a week is such a long time in sport.
“I’m really just trying to link the weeks together and get some decent game time. The focus for me now is to make sure that when I play I actually play well. I’m not thinking about anything beyond that.
“I’ve reached a huge milestone. Since that Castres game away I really haven’t missed a training session or a weights session.
“I’ve been available for every game and that’s been a huge part of the process. Craig Joiner used to say that the best way to get fit is to keep fit, and that’s my mindset at the moment.”
